基于近似随机优势度的随机多属性决策方法 被引量:2

ASD-Degree-Based Method of Stochastic Multiattribute Decision Making

摘要 针对属性值为随机变量形式的决策问题,提出了一种随机多属性决策分析方法.首先给出了近似随机优势准则的描述及相关分析,并提出了近似随机优势度的定义和计算公式;然后,依据近似随机优势准则判断并确定两两方案之间比较所具有的优势关系,进而计算得到方案之间的近似随机优势度,并构建相应的近似随机优势度矩阵.进一步地,通过计算可以得到每个方案的总体相对近似随机优势程度,从而得到所有方案的排序结果.最后,通过一个算例说明了所给出方法的可行性和有效性. A method of stochastic multiattribute decision making was proposed where the attribute values were in form of stochastic variables.Describing and analyzing the ASD rules,the ASD degree was defined with its calculation formula given.Then,dominance relations on pairwise comparisons of alternatives were established according to ASD rules,thus ASD degrees of alternative pairs were calculated and the ASD degree matrix with regard to each attribute was built.Furthermore, total relative ASD degree of each alternative is calculated to obtain the ranking of alternatives.A numerical example is given to illustrate the feasibility and validity of the proposed method.
